Eisenhower Park
Eisenhower Park is a park in Schaumburg Township, Cook, Illinois. Eisenhower Park is situated nearby to the planetarium Observatory, as well as near North Twin Park.Places of Interest Nearby

Medieval Times Dinner and Tournament is an American dinner theater featuring staged medieval-style games, sword-fighting, and jousting. Medieval Times Entertainment, the holding company, is headquartered in Irving, Texas. Medieval Times is situated 1¼ miles east of Eisenhower Park.

Hoffman Estates High School is a public four-year high school located in Hoffman Estates, Illinois, a northwest suburb of Chicago, in the United States. Hoffman Estates High School is situated 1 mile southwest of Eisenhower Park.

St. Alexius Medical Center is a faith-based community hospital located in Hoffman Estates, Illinois, a northwest suburb of Chicago. Saint Alexius Medical Center is situated 2½ miles west of Eisenhower Park.

Schaumburg is a city in Chicagoland, best known for its ever popular Woodfield Mall, the largest mall in Illinois. Its name is derived from a place in Germany.

South Barrington is a residential suburb in Cook County, Illinois, United States, south of Barrington. Per the 2020 census, the population was 5,077. Inverness is a suburban village in Cook County, Illinois, United States. Per the 2020 census, the population was 7,616. Inverness is situated 3½ miles north of Eisenhower Park.
